NEW DELHI: As the fog lifted, people in the north and north-western regions heaved Sigh of relief after reeling under cold ‘wave that has claimed 153 lives so far.

With three more deaths reported, the toll in Uttar Pradesh rose to 24, while the eastern state of Bihar has listed 118 deaths so far,

Amritsar and Chandigarh, in the plains of Punjab, experienced the coldest day in the past more than a decade when the mercury plummeted to 0.3 degree Celsius,

Srinagar and Jammu, in the picturesque state of Jammu and Kashmir, were reeling under minus two and two Celsius.
